"Each new stimulus is collected and eviscerated, reiterated, shaded, excavated, transformed and re-proposed until the work itself becomes a new stimulus. It doesn't matter if the initial cue, always concrete, remains recognizable or not: at the end of the process it becomes something else." Paolo Facchinetti.

Paolo Facchinetti was born in 1953 in Nembro, where he now lives and works. He began his artistic training at the Carrara Academy of Fine Arts in Bergamo by attending drawing and nude courses under the guidance of Mino Marra; later also the master Cesare Benaglia had a strong importance in the growth of Paolo, who attended his studio and the Valbrembo 77 Artistic Group from 1985 to 1989.

From the beginning his art is characterized by a strong dualism . Abstract art and chromatic-formal research coexist with portraiture and the ability to capture the essence of the subject. The physical-gestural movement of the moment in which the color settles on the canvas is always recognizable and is often a fundamental part of the work.

Since 1972 Paolo Facchinetti has exhibited his works in numerous solo and group exhibitions and participates in national and international art exhibitions. We remember the itinerant project "13 × 17", curated by Philippe Daverio and Jean Blanchaert, (with stops in Bologna, Rome, Venice, Palermo, Potenza, Milan and Naples), the realization in 2007 of the cover of the album "Requiem " for the Italian group Verdena, his participation - one of the two Italian artists selected - at the Biennale del Disegno, in Pilsen (Czech Republic), and the recent exhibitions at the Viamoronisedici Spazio Arte Gallery in Bergamo, at the Trescore Library (BG) and the solo exhibition at the Bernareggi Museum in Bergamo.
